How SensoRy AI uses ChatGPT to turn wildfire sensor data into actionable alerts

OpenAI profiles SensoRy AI, a wildfire sensor network that uses ChatGPT to explain complex readings. Here is what the real-world system teaches businesses.

Detecting wildfires with ChatGPT

OpenAI’s September 14 video profiles SensoRy AI, a wildfire early-warning system founded by Ryan Honary. The system monitors terrain using physical sensors and applies AI to detect possible fire conditions. ChatGPT’s role, according to the video, is to help translate complex sensor readings into clear information that firefighters and residents can understand and act on. It is a useful example of AI supporting a real operational system—not replacing the sensors, domain experts or emergency response.

What does the SensoRy AI system do?

SensoRy AI began as Honary’s fifth-grade science project after he saw the destruction caused by California wildfires. The company says the project developed into a sensor network and wildfire risk-management platform designed for early detection.

OpenAI’s video description says the field sensors monitor heat, smoke, flame and plume activity in remote terrain. When the system identifies a potential fire, sensor data can be converted into a clearer alert for people responsible for responding.

That distinction matters. The physical network observes conditions in the environment. SensoRy AI’s own detection platform analyzes those signals. ChatGPT provides an interface and communication layer around the data described in the video.

How is ChatGPT used for wildfire detection?

The video shows two practical interaction patterns. Honary uses ChatGPT hands-free while working in the field, and he demonstrates a walkie-talkie interface that lets firefighters ask questions about a potential fire.

This is less about asking a general chatbot for an opinion and more about making specialized system information accessible. A conversational interface can explain readings, summarize what changed and present the result in language suited to a responder or resident.

The quality of that answer still depends on the underlying data, integration and operating rules. A language model cannot compensate for a failed sensor, missing coverage or an incorrect escalation policy. Emergency decisions must remain with trained authorities.

Is SensoRy AI operating outside a prototype?

Yes. The City of Laguna Beach announced on August 20, 2026 that it selected SensoRy AI’s wildfire risk-management sensor network for deployment. The city said sensors would monitor high-risk open space and selected inner canyons, provide rapid notifications to first responders and connect to a broader regional network around the wildland-urban interface.

SensoRy AI also reports a permanent deployment in Irvine Open Space Preserve following pilot work with local partners. These deployments do not prove that every alert will be correct or that the system can eliminate wildfire risk. They do show that the concept has moved beyond a classroom demonstration into evaluated field use.

What can businesses learn from this AI implementation?

Start with the real-world signal

Useful AI systems begin with dependable inputs. For SensoRy AI, those inputs come from environmental sensors. In a business, they might come from a CRM, support inbox, production system, inspection form or connected device.

Give AI a bounded responsibility

The language model has a specific role: helping people understand and interact with complex data. It does not need unrestricted control of the full operation to create value.

Design for the person who must act

Raw data is only useful when it reaches the right person in time and in a form they can interpret. The interface, alert language and escalation path are part of the product—not secondary details.

Validate outside the demonstration

A compelling prototype is the beginning. Field conditions, noisy signals, connectivity failures, false alerts and security requirements determine whether a system is dependable. SensoRy AI’s path from a hair-dryer experiment in a garage to monitored outdoor deployments illustrates the importance of iteration in the environment where the system will operate.

What safeguards would a system like this require?

Public-safety technology needs layered controls. Sensor health should be observable, alerts should preserve the originating evidence, and operators should be able to see uncertainty rather than receiving false confidence. Communications need secure access and a fallback path when AI, connectivity or a device is unavailable.

The system should also make the division of responsibility explicit. AI can organize and explain information; trained responders decide how to assess and respond to a suspected fire.
